> > ECP1 is a CCIE lab prep class taught by Chesapeake.  Its based on the
book
> > "Bridges, routers and switches" by Bruce Caslow.  If you sign up for the
> > class, you get a free copy of the book plus "Advanced IP routing in
Cisco
> > Networks by Terry Slattery(CCIE 1026) and Bill Burton(CCIE 1119).
> >
> > The short version of this report would be to say - WOW!!!
> >
> > Here's a bit longer version.
> >
> > I had Bruce Caslow as the instructor.  Fred Ingham also teaching this
> class
> > sometimes.  Bruce was awsome.  He focused on creating a strategy for how
> to
> > solve the CCIE level problems.  We also focused on "spotting the
issues".
> > Now, when I look at a lab scenario I immediately create a gotcha list.
> > There was a split of about 35% lecture and 65% lab.  The class days went
> > very long.  830am to between 830pm to 11pm.  Though you could stay as
late
> > as you want to use the gear.  You really get two weeks of training in
one.
> > With that said, the $3500 for the class is an excellent value.  As you
all
> > know from his book, Bruce really knows his stuff.  He's also very
> > motivational.  There were two students to each pod.  Each pod had enough
> > routers, switches and interfaces to do anything that may show up in the
> lab.
> > If you haven't looked, his class is booked up many months in advance.
If
> > your looking to do the lab, I'd take this class about a month before.
You
> > will want the time after coming home to make the tools second nature.
> This
> > class REALLY helped.  I hope the final proof will be shown on May
27/28(My
> > lab date).  Thats all for now.  Back to "spotting the issues".
